    CMA CGM is implementing Rate Restoration Initiative 4 (RRI04) for shipments from North European and Mediterranean ports destined for the United States, Canada and Mexico, as well as inland destinations accessible via these ports.

    Commencing 1 May 2024, unless otherwise specified, a Rate Restoration Initiative 4 (RRI04) will be enforced on tariff or service contract rates for all cargo within the scope of this tariff.

    The rate adjustments are as follows:

    • US$200 per 20-foot container (Dry & Reefer)
    • US$400 per 40-foot/40-foot High Cube/45-foot container (Dry & Reefer)
    • Out of Gauge containers are excluded from this rate

    North Europe includes North France, the United Kingdom, Ireland, Scandinavia, Poland, and Baltic countries, and selected ports in North Spain (Bilbao, Gijon). The Mediterranean includes Malta, Italy, Spain (Algeciras, Valencia, Barcelona, Sagunto), ports in the Adriatic region, North Africa, and Morocco, excluding Egypt.

    Destinations include ports along the US East Coast, US Gulf Coast, Canada, and Mexico, as well as all inland destinations accessible via these ports.
